NC S291
Bill
AI Summary
-
Eliminates separate tuition rates for in-state nonpublic school students in the North Carolina Virtual Public School (NCVPS) program, allowing them to enroll in courses tuition-free.
-
Requires the NCVPS Director to report annual enrollment numbers and instructional costs for nonpublic school students to the State Board of Education.
-
Extends free NCVPS course access at the same rates as public school students to students in Part 1, 2, and 3 nonpublic schools and home school students.
-
Maintains a separate, higher tuition rate for out-of-state students, which the State Board of Education will continue to adjust as appropriate.
-
Appropriates $700,000 in recurring funds for fiscal year 2017-2018 to the Department of Public Instruction to cover increased NCVPS enrollment and instructional costs for nonpublic school students, effective July 1, 2017.
